« Reply #10 on: December 30, 2009, 10:29:26 PM »
would it not be simplest to have the upgraded ingenery squads have the demo ability.  That would transform a disadvantage into a healthy advantage.  What I mean is that it takes 4 charges to blow a full sized bridge and a four man ingenery squad can place all at once while any other faction except the British has to take twice as long because one or two guys have to place two charges.  So, why not eh?

-Wehr don't have Demo charges. (use werfers, incendiary, gholiats, stukas, etc but no demo chargers...)

-American ings can put 3 at the same time, then the last one, in Little infantry bridges, just need 2 charger (i know the 4/2 charges counts as one)

-British can put all at the same time, plus commandos can use demo charges in any place... i mean ANY , from strategics points to ROFLCOPTER.... 4/2 can place demo charges in bridges and the others 2/4 covers.

i think Russian need the same difficulty as PE and the Ostheer the same facility as British... talking about demo charges of course... just for a litle balance... anyway (:
